I first heard this song in the “Great Gatsby” trailer that I posted a few weeks back.  Jack White’s cover on the classic U2 song, “Love is Blindness” totally rocks it, and, in my opinion, is better than the original version.

Jack White’s cover was on the album of U2 covers that was created in celebration of the band’s 20th anniversary of their classic album, “Achtung Baby.”  Personally, I like Jack White’s version better than the original U2 version.

I love the emotion and pure rawness in Jack White’s voice.  The revved up drum and over exaggerated guitar in this version give the song a more of a raw rock feel as well.  Jack White’s touch is so rock ‘n’ roll and so special, everything he does is gold.

He is an amazing musician and while was most well known for the White Stripes, has done some amazing solo work and group work since.  For example, if you have never heard of the Dead Weather, I suggest you check out THIS heavy rock song and download the rest of the album immediately.
